Court orders minister to unblock Rebel Media publisher from X

Briefs | 09/12/2023 5:25 pm EDT
Then Minster of Canadian Heritage Steven Guilbeault at a press conference on Nov. 3, 2020./ Photo by Andrew Meade.

Environment Minister Steven Guilbeault must unblock Rebel News founder Ezra Levant on X Corp.  (formerly Twitter), according to an order issued by a federal court justice.
